S1138 (2027) The Hire, Erection and Dismantling of Scaffold Services
Description
NIE Networks is conducting a Preliminary Market Engagement (PME) to gather insights from the market before initiating a procurement process for Contract S1138 Hire, Erection and Dismantling of Scaffold. This engagement aims to assess the market's interest and capabilities in delivering Contract S1138 (2027), identify potential solutions and innovative approaches, and develop an effective procurement strategy. This PME is open to all suppliers and is intended to be a collaborative effort to ensure a robust and successful procurement process.
The Hire, Erection and Dismantling of Scaffold Services may include as follows:
• Hire, Erection and Dismantling of Scaffold (Distribution Overhead lines),
• Hire, Erection and Dismantling of Scaffold (Distribution and Transmission Substations and Transmission Overhead Lines)
The services will include:
Hire, Erection and Dismantling of Scaffold (Distribution Overhead Lines)
• The design, erection, inspection and dismantling of scaffold to facilitate NIE Networks’ teams with:
• the erection / maintenance / replacement of electricity poles
• the installation and repair of Low Voltage under eave wires and cables at customer properties
• Erection and dismantling of scaffold to facilitate NIE Networks’ fault and emergency response works where required
Hire, Erection and Dismantling of Scaffold (Distribution and Transmission Substations and Transmission Overhead Lines)
• The design, erection, inspection and dismantling of scaffold to facilitate NIE Networks’ teams with:
• the installation / maintenance / replacement of substation plant and apparatus
• the erection / maintenance / replacement of electricity poles and towers
• Roadside protection schemes to assist with raising and lowering of overhead lines
• Erection and dismantling of scaffold to facilitate NIE Networks’ fault and emergency response works where required
